What are EXO Modules in Canvas?

Each MTU Module repeat gets a unique EXO CRN which is taken from the Banner System.

All students who are registered to take an August assessment will be enrolled on the relevant Canvas EXO.

EXO modules are module-based rather than CRN-based but the original semester 1 or 2 CRN structures have been retained with these modules in the form of what Canvas calls sections.

Making an assessment available for all, or for specific, CRN repeats.

EXO Canvas modules are module-based rather than CRN-based. This means that there will be one EXO canvas module for all instances of the module. All CRNs associated with this module will be available in the module as "sections" (different groupings of students).


If you wish to make the same assessment available to all instances/ CRNs repeating the module:

  1. Create your Canvas assignment as usual until you get to the “Assign” option.
  2. Set the "Assign to" option to "everyone

If you wish to provide a specific group of students  - according to the module instance/ CRN - with a specific assignment, different to another group of students

  1. Create your Canvas assignment as usual until you get to the “Assign” option.
  2. Set the "Assign to" option to select the relevant section or sections - based on the CRN - from the Module section list which appears

Do I have to use an EXO module for reapeat Examinations?

Technically most Semester 1 and 2 modules should - by default - remain available to staff and students over the Summer for the purposes of repeat coursework submission. There can be exceptions to this however, so the general recommendation is that you setup the relevant EXO module for resubmission, as this represents a "cleaner" option:

  • It will definitely be available to only the students who have registered to resubmit during the Summer.
  • EXO modules are module and not CRN based so a single assignment in an EXO module can facilitate submisison from multiple CRNs.
  • EXO modules are generally less cluttered than Semester 1/2 modules, so it can be made clear to the students what specifically is required for submission over the summer - and when.
